Understanding Companion Planting
Companion planting involves growing different plants in proximity for mutual benefits. These benefits can include pest control, pollination enhancement, and improved nutrient uptake. More importantly, specific plant combinations can deter pathogens and reduce the risk of disease transmission between plants.
Diseases in the garden are often caused by fungi, bacteria, or viruses, which can spread from one plant to another through soil, water, insects, or even direct contact. By strategically choosing companion plants, you can create an environment that minimizes these risks.
1. Know Your Plants’ Needs
Compatibility in Growth Conditions
Before diving into plant pairings, it’s crucial to understand the light, water, and nutrient requirements of the plants you intend to grow together. Some species thrive in full sun while others prefer partial shade; some require moist soil while others flourish in drier conditions.
Growing compatible plants together not only maximizes their growth potential but also creates an environment where disease is less likely to thrive. For example, pairing drought-tolerant succulents with moisture-loving ferns could lead to rot or fungal issues.
Assessing Growth Habits
Consider the growth habits of your chosen plants: tall species can overshadow shorter ones, while sprawling vines might choke out less aggressive plants. Understanding these dynamics will help you avoid planting arrangements that promote humidity and provide shelter for pests and diseases.
2. Utilize Natural Barriers
Employing Physical Separation
One effective way to reduce disease spread is to use physical barriers between susceptible plants. For instance, planting taller crops like sunflowers or corn can create a protective shade for more delicate vegetables that may be prone to sunburn or certain pests.
Additionally, using herbs like basil or rosemary as companion plants can create a buffer zone against diseases due to their natural insect-repellent properties. These herbs can deter pests that may carry pathogens between closely planted crops.
Spacing and Airflow
Spacing is another critical factor in disease prevention. Proper air circulation around plants helps reduce humidity levels that often foster the growth of fungi and bacteria. By ensuring adequate spacing between your crops—especially those known to have viral issues—you create a less hospitable environment for diseases.
3. Choose Disease-Resistant Varieties
Research Resistant Varieties
When selecting companion plants, always opt for disease-resistant varieties whenever possible. Many seed companies offer cultivars bred specifically for resistance to common diseases such as blight or rust.
For instance, if you’re planting tomatoes—prone to blight—consider pairing them with marigolds known for their pest-repellent qualities. At the same time, look for tomato varieties resistant to specific diseases prevalent in your region.
Indigenous Plants as Companions
Indigenous or native plants are often well-adapted to local conditions and may have built-in resistance to regional pathogens. Including these plants in your garden can not only enhance biodiversity but also offer a natural defense against diseases affecting other cultivated species.
4. Strategically Use Trap Crops
Understanding Trap Cropping
Trap cropping is an advanced form of companion planting where you introduce a less desirable plant next to your more valuable crops. The idea here is that pests will be drawn to the trap crop instead of the main crop, thus reducing the chances of disease spread through pest infestation.
For example, growing mustard greens can lure aphids away from cabbage family vegetables (like broccoli) while simultaneously acting as a biofumigant once they’re tilled back into the soil. This technique not only minimizes disease risk but also aids in soil health.
Timing and Crop Rotation
Implementing trap crops should be timed with your regular planting schedule. Additionally, practicing crop rotation each season helps disrupt pathogen life cycles in the soil. Never plant members of the same family in the same spot year after year; instead, rotate with unrelated species that do not share vulnerabilities.
5. Foster Biodiversity
Interplanting Techniques
Biodiversity is a key tenet in preventing disease spread within gardens. Interplanting various species not only creates visual interest but also helps build a resilient ecosystem where specific pests and diseases find it difficult to establish themselves.
For instance, interplanting legumes like beans alongside corn can improve soil nitrogen levels while warding off specific pests due to their varied growth stages and root structures.
Avoiding Monoculture Practices
Monoculture—growing a single crop over extensive areas—can lead to increased vulnerability against certain diseases since pathogens may easily spread among identical hosts. By diversifying your plant selection and incorporating companion planting practices, you drastically reduce this risk.
6. Use Medicinal and Aromatic Herbs
Benefits of Medicinal Plants
Many herbs possess natural antimicrobial properties that can assist in keeping your garden healthy. Incorporating herbs such as oregano, thyme, and mint into your garden can act as natural defenses against disease-causing organisms.
These herbs also attract beneficial insects which prey on pests that might otherwise transmit diseases to other crops within your garden ecosystem.
Companion Planting with Culinary Herbs
Culinary herbs like basil paired with tomatoes not only complement each other flavor-wise but also help suppress thrips and aphids—two common pests associated with viral diseases in vegetable gardens.
7. Monitor and Maintain Your Garden Health
Regular Inspections
To minimize disease spread effectively through companion planting strategies, consistent monitoring of your garden is essential. Regularly inspect your plants for any signs of distress or pest activity so you can intervene early before issues escalate into larger problems.
Pay attention to discoloration on leaves or spots that could signal fungal or bacterial infections; prompt removal of affected plants will help contain any potential outbreaks.
Soil Health is Key
Healthy soil leads to healthy plants! Implement organic practices such as composting and mulching while ensuring proper drainage will create an environment that encourages robust growth and naturally minimizes disease susceptibility.
Soil tests may also identify deficiencies or imbalances that need addressing before they impact plant health negatively.
